Transaction 2b3b6326a9752900a84f90500f05fbb54afdb735df28a22f95103593e135a2bb
1 Input
1 Output
-
2b3b6326a9752900a84f90500f05fbb54afdb735df28a22f95103593e135a2bb:0
- value
- 1689330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cc73fe3561d1242b5d6a1a4ebf89d30accc6b8a OP_EQUAL
- address
- 3JuBei9Km8izmtZry1fcZWFAiwpPfRVM2s